Conclusion: HOA insurance covers common areas and shared buildings, liability for accidents or injuries that occur on the property, and damage to the building’s exterior. It can also cover legal fees related to disputes within the community. However, it typically does not cover individual units or personal belongings of homeowners.

WebA DP3 insurance policy, also known as Dwelling Fire Policy 3, is a type of homeowners insurance that provides coverage for rental properties or non-owner occupied homes. It specifically covers damages caused by fire and other perils such as lightning, windstorms, hail, explosions, and civil unrest. WebExpert Answer. Web15 mei 2024 · Types of Homeowners Policies Most policies cover losses against fire, storm damage, and other named perils. Depending on your coverage, your policy pays for repairs, loss of use, liability claims, medical payments, and more. Types of policies can cover different types of losses, including basic, broad, and special (all-perils) coverage.
